Supervisor, Field Service

3 weeks ago


London, Canada Coca-Cola Canada Bottling Limited Full time

Facility Location
- London

Shift/Hours - Primary Monday to Friday, Days. Weekends are on call.

**About This Opportunity**:
Reporting to the Manager, Distribution Centre, the Field Service Supervisor oversees a staff of Equipment Service employees responsible for the installation and service of Cold Drink Equipment. The Field Service Supervisor is responsible for overseeing daily operations: managing schedules, coaching and developing team, performance management, setting and ensuring Key Business Indicator (KBI) targets and goals are met, driving initiatives and results, auditing employee performance, review of report data to analyze results and ability to enter data into our business systems.

In addition to managing the direct employees, the supervisor is Subject Matter Expert (SME) liaison with internal/ external customers to respond to needs, seek feedback on performance, and creating a positive experience for the customer.

**Responsibilities**:

- Provide leadership and guidance to the Field Operations team
- Accountable for delivering the Field Service vision and strategy
- Drive employee engagement and organizational health
- Translate Company business data to monitor results
- Coach, motivate and develop talent
- Enhance intellectual capital through training, rewarding, and retaining the Best of the Best
- Performance Management
- Improve productivity of the workforce through current technology enablement, training, process improvement and identifying best practices (e.g., 5S & Lean methodology)
- Audit Fountain Equipment installations to ensure adherence to guidelines and policies of Coca-Cola.
- Work cross functionally with Equipment Installation Planning and Sales resources to support special projects as well as routine activities.
- Enhance customer relationships both internal and external of the company

**Qualifications**:

- Bachelor's Degree or equivalent required
- 1-3 years experience required
- Effective coaching and talent development
- Ability to analyze and interpret spreadsheets/business data
- Supervisory experience preferred
- Experience in Equipment Service preferred
- Outlook and Excel proficiency
